Composer. Born 29 April 1899 in Washington, District of Columbia, USA. Died 24 May 1974.

Awards

Academy Awards1 nominated

  • Nominated1962Best Original Musical Score · Paris Blues
Other awards8 won
  • Won1999Pulitzer Prize Special Citations and Awards: Pulitzer Prize Special Citations and Awards
  • Won1971honorary doctor of the Berklee College of Music: honorary doctor of the Berklee College of Music
  • Won1971Songwriters Hall of Fame: Songwriters Hall of Fame
  • Won1969Presidential Medal of Freedom: Presidential Medal of Freedom
  • Won1968Grammy Trustees Award: Grammy Trustees Award
  • Won1966Grammy Lifetime Achievement Award: Grammy Lifetime Achievement Award
  • Won1959Spingarn Medal: Spingarn Medal
  • Won1957German Film Award for best original music: German Film Award for best original music · Jonas
